3DMIMO信道建模与仿真验证
现有的多输入多输出(MIMO)信道仿真模型主要基于二维(2D)平面,不能反映实际的三维(3D)电波传播环境。在WINNER2D模型的基础上研究建立3DMIMO信道仿真平台。加入空间垂直维后,天线方向图需要从2D扩展至3D,并对3D天线阵列构成的MIMO系统进行建模。利用实验数据对城市微小区场景进行仿真验证,可以看出三维MIMO信道参数仿真与实验结果符合较好。3DMIMO信道间的相关性要比2D大,但3DMIM0的信道容量相比2D会有比较大的提升。...
